One of the nicest things about the new, 2014 year model of the Kawasaki KLX110 is its universal fun capabilities: this bike is a great choice for riders age 8 and older, but adults can also enjoy it, making a great fun resource for the entire family.
The 111cc 4-stroke carbureted engine is mated to a 4-speed gearbox with automatic clutch, making riding really easy for the youngsters and fun for more seasoned off-road enthusiasts. The small engine is canted forward and allows the steel frame to be lower: this means a smaller seat height and more confidence for the new riders.

The electric ignition and engine kill switches are conveniently placed on the handlebars and thanks to a screw-type throttle limiter, adults can decide how fast will the young be able to ride. Drum brakes ensure there is enough stopping force on tap, while at the same time being less susceptible to malfunction when deep in dirt.

At $2,199 (€1,673) the 2014 Kawasaki KLX110 is truly affordable, especially as it will not be easily outgrown by the kids and can be a great training bike for the future champions.
